An Australian law is called the Disability Discrimination Act. It got started in 1992. It is unlawful to treat someone improperly due to their disability. The law is crucial to many areas of life. This covers work, education, and building Availability. The DDA seeks to create a more level society. It enables everyone to have the same rights and options. It is an ideal tool for those with disabilities. It guarantees that you have the same choices as others. This is even more accurate if you're looking for work.
The DDA protects you during your entire job journey. It starts when you see a job advertisement. It continues through the interview and hiring process. The protection remains once you are employed. To use a DES provider, you need a referral. You get this referral from a job capacity assessor. This usually happens through your Centrelink account. You must be getting an eligible income support payment to qualify.
The process involves a meeting with an assessor. They will talk to you about your goals. They will discuss the support you need. After this assessment, they will give you a referral code. You can then take this code to the DES provider you choose.

Your DES provider does not disappear once you have a job. They offer ongoing support. This is called post-placement support. They will check in with you and your employer. They make sure everything is going well. They can help solve any small problems before they get big. This support can last for up to 26 weeks.
